So yesterday (tuesday) we began preparation for the Afaayo HIV programme with a new set of Ugandan leaders. There isn’t as many of them compared to last weeks group. It wasn’t easy getting back to work again after a great few days off but we took to the task at hand and got straight to it! So today (wednesday) we were ready to get to work and headed of to the HIV centre to begin our first days work. We played games with the kids first which was a lot of fun then we had some morning tea with pumpkin cake, boiled eggs and fried potatoes. Not bad at all really. After this we had main deck which was full of singing, dancing, drama and laughs. Todays theme was Eternal love so our drama team prepared a version of “The Lost Sheep” which went down well. After Main Deck we split up into age groups to do Bible studies, crafts and games. It was quite tough seeing the kids as they have such a horrible virus put upon them through no fault of their own which is a huge eye opener for all of us. Luckily we have another 2 days working with them so it will be great showing them Love and Joy through our activities.
